As an ambitious player, I have learned a couple of important lessons while gambling over the decades. Regardless if you like to play at the land based’ type or the many internet casinos. Here are my all important codes of wagering, many of which may be deemed clear thinking, but if accepted they will assist you in going a long distance to departing with a sense of enjoyment.
Rule one: Go into a casino with a predetermined figure that you are ready and can afford to wager – How much would it cost for an evening out on food, cocktails, entrance fees and tips? This is a great sum to utilize.
Rule two: Don’t pack your credit card with you – or any way of withdrawing money out. Don’t worry about money for the cab if you burn all your cash; most taxi drivers, in particular the cabs booked by casinos, will drive you to your house and are more than happy to wait for the cash when you get back.
Rule 3: Stay to your predetermined cap. I frequently envision what I’d like to buy if I profit. The previous time I was able to go, I decided I’d really would like to purchase a new digital camera which cost about $400, so that was my predetermined cutoff. As soon as I achieved this value, I stopped. Just walk away. Even if Clairvoyant Carla herself gives you the next number for the roulette wheel, pay no attention to her and back off. Depart comfortable in the understanding that you will be going into town and buying a nice brand-new toy!
